Fifth graders began what we imagine to be, a yearlong relationship with Westside Campaign Against Hunger on West 86th Street. Three groups have volunteered thus far, and one more group will continue the work of helping to stock and prepare food for families' to 'shop'.
According to their website, "West Side Campaign Against Hunger changes our perception of hungry people by working in partnership with them, providing food with dignity, and empowering customers to find solutions."
Fifth graders had the wonderful idea of helping as well. WSCAH taught students about the difference between wholesale versus retail Instead of donating one retail turkey, the students decided to assist WSCAH by donating at least $1 each to help fund a number of turkeys in time for Thanksgiving! So far, students have donated $37!
